Investing in Sector ETFs for Targeted Growth and Diversification
Sector Exchange Traded Funds (ETFs) present a compelling avenue for investors targeting both targeted growth and diversification within their portfolios. By concentrating on specific industries, such as technology, healthcare, or energy, investors have the ability to amplify their exposure amongst sectors exhibiting strong growth prospects. Moreover, ETFs offer a efficient way for achieve diversification, as they typically hold a basket of securities within a particular sector. This strategy helps to mitigate risk by allocating investments across multiple companies, thus creating a more resilient portfolio.
In conclusion, investing in sector ETFs offers a valuable tool with investors wanting to tailor their portfolios in accordance with their specific investment goals. Nonetheless, it's crucial for conduct thorough research and understand the risks and rewards associated of each sector before making any investment decisions.
